Deichmann Shoes has an exciting opportunity to join their growing business as a Cover Store Manager supporting the store in Norwich and other surrounding stores. This full‑time permanent role offers a competitive salary of £30,500 per annum and requires flexible availability across the week.
Training & Promotion
The training for this role takes place at the Northampton Store and the Stratford store in London. After initial training, Cover Managers build their understanding of how Deichmann stores operate by providing managerial cover across a cluster of stores and are positioned for promotion to Store Manager.
